Default jdm b16a cams vs usa GSR cams?

im running a stock b16a with p30 in my civic and i have a chance to get a set of gsr cams from my friend for $20 because he now has blox turbo cams. was wondering if the gsr cams are more agressive than my b16 cams. i know they are more agressive than the usa b16. if they are more agressive how much gain could i see from these cams maybe 2 or 3 horse?

if they were from an auto, and 5 speed vtec cam would be in your best interest. Also, the cylinder head from an auto like you have, has only single valve springs on both intake and exhaust valves, no dual on the intake like most vtec heads
